Lenovo Reports Strong Quarterly Results

Chinese tech giant Lenovo Group reported a 20% rise in its quarterly revenue on Thursday, beating market estimates. The positive results come amid signs of recovery in the global personal computer market.

Lenovo's revenue for the quarter ended March 31, 2023, reached US$15.3 billion, surpassing analysts' expectations of $14.6 billion. The company's net income also increased by 11% year-over-year to $432 million.

Key Factors Driving Lenovo's Growth

  • Strong demand for PCs: The global PC market is showing signs of recovery, driven by increased demand from businesses, educational institutions, and consumers.
  • Market share gains: Lenovo has gained market share in key segments, such as gaming PCs and workstations.
  • Expansion in non-PC businesses: Lenovo has expanded its operations into non-PC businesses, including data centers, mobile devices, and smart devices, contributing to its revenue growth.

Analysts Weigh In on Lenovo's Performance

Analysts have attributed Lenovo's strong performance to its diverse product portfolio, efficient cost management, and strategic acquisitions.

IDC, a leading technology research firm, noted that Lenovo's "strong quarter of double-digit year-on-year revenue growth" is a testament to its solid execution and ability to adapt to changing market conditions.

Lenovo's Bright Outlook

Lenovo remains optimistic about the future and expects continued growth in the coming quarters.

The company is investing heavily in research and development, particularly in AI-powered technologies and cloud-based solutions.

Lenovo's CEO, Yuanqing Yang, stated: "We are confident in our ability to continue to deliver strong financial performance and drive sustainable growth over the long term."
